The Edo State Governor, Senator Monday Okpebholo, has dissolved the executives of all state boards of government agencies and parastatals in the state.

Gistmania reports that the governor also relieved all Permanent Secretaries appointed from outside the State Public/Civil Service and all political appointees of their appointments.

The Chief Press Secretary to the Governor, Fred Itua, disclosed this on Wednesday in a statement made available to newsmen in Benin City.

Okpebholo said the dissolution of the affected officers was with immediate effect.

He, however, advised the affected appointees to hand over all government properties in their possession to the most senior public officer in their respective ministries, departments and agencies.

The statement reads in part: “It is hereby announced for the information of the general public that the Governor of Edo State, His Excellency, Senator Monday Okpebholo, has approved the dissolution of executives of all boards, agencies, and parastatals in Edo State Public Service with immediate effect.

“In addition, all Permanent Secretaries appointed from outside the State Public/Civil Service and all political appointees are hereby relieved of their appointments.

“Accordingly, all affected appointees are to hand over all government properties in their possession to the most senior public officer in their respective ministries, departments, and agencies,”
he said.
